HIGHLANDS Pacific has announced its new exploration program at Nong River in Papua New Guinea nearby the Ok Tedi cooper-gold mine.
In the past, the Nong River exploration licence has been explored by a number of majoring mining companies including BHP Billiton.
According to the Brisbane-based company which focuses highly on its PNG market, it will be solely funding the exploration.
Highlands Pacific says the exploration will initially cost $3.2millon and will consist of 860km of airborne electromagnetic survey over both exploration licences and 2,400m of diamond drilling.
Highlands Pacific believes the use of geophysical surveys with previous work on the ground will assist in pinpointing areas for drilling.
